Hunt continues
Serbia's war crimes prosecutor said yesterday that despite an intense
search for Europe's most wanted war crimes fugitives, Ratko Mladic and
Radovan Karadzic, their whereabouts remain a mystery. "We don't have
new evidence about Mladic's whereabouts, and when we get it we'll
arrest him and send him to the UN war crimes tribunal in The Hague,"
Vladimir Vukcevic, who heads a state team in charge of the hunt for
the Bosnian Serb war crimes suspects, told The Associated Press in an
interview. He also said that Serbia's security services have recently
discovered "surprising" evidence that Karadzic was in Serbia as
recently as "around 2004." (AP)
